Intelligence Briefing
Official OpenAI Forum bios identify Brown as a Member of Technical Staff and describe him as a leading researcher in multi-agent reasoning, known for work on superhuman poker and human-level Diplomacy systems before OpenAI.
PhD, — Computer Science, Carnegie Mellon University
